Even if this café/wine bar wasn't at one of the city's busiest intersections, on the corner between the Frari and the Scuola of San Rocco, it would be worth the trip. It's small but with an amazing variety of drinks, cicheti, and pastries, plus an energetic and welcoming atmosphere. There's room for only a very few seats inside, but you'll want to be at a table outside anyway, watching tourists, students, commuters, and locals stream past.
